Output 40aa53bc8c14a1807945ef4020f54f3855ac945328cfe2e6b64260ddaf1130c5:1

value
1844710
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b31055e4e1e756b47b332063c64efb0731ebc31 OP_EQUALVERIFY OP_CHECKSIG
address
17raQRbMUXUkJGSTy3KSJ9prTZgRig7hVw
transaction
40aa53bc8c14a1807945ef4020f54f3855ac945328cfe2e6b64260ddaf1130c5
confirmations
120151
spent
true